Small Acts of Kindness
In recent weeks, the Covid19 Virus has impacted everyone’s lives across the Alle-Kiski Valley.
Many have and will step up to help family, friends and others they don’t even know.
The Stroller wants to recognize those around us who are performing these small acts of kindness for others during this stressful time.
Send a short, one-paragraph note highlighting someone and how they helped you, your family or your organization to The Stroller at vndnews@tribweb.com.
From Pat Koedel of Sarver, Buffalo Township:
“I want to recognize my sweet nephew, Braden Campbell. He’s been delivering delicious soup to my door so that I don’t have to go out. He is always thinking of others and I want him - and others - to know that I appreciate it.”

Goodwill urges public to hold on to donations
Goodwill of Southwest Pennsylvania urges donors to hold on to donations until the donation centers reopen.
Items left outside centers will be exposed to the weather and possibly damaged or ruined. Donations will be needed when government authorities allow the centers to reopen.
